The main problem in formal learning today is the low absorption of students in understanding the material. This can be seen from the average student learning outcomes which are always still low. Low learning outcomes are indicated because the learning conditions are still conventional (lectures, practicums, and discussions). This study aims to determine the effect of pair programming learning models on learning outcomes of vocational high school students. This research was conducted through a literature review and relevant research results and was continued through a Focus Group Discussion (FGD). From the research it was found that there was a significant positive influence between the variable pair programming learning model and student learning outcomes, which means that student learning outcomes can be improved through the application of the pair programming learning model.

The main problem in formal learning is that teachers carry out learning with direct learning models and lectures. The right learning model can maximize student learning outcomes and learning objectives will be achieved. This study aims to determine the effect of the Problem Based Learning (PBL) learning model on the learning outcomes of vocational high school students. This research was conducted through a literature review and relevant research results and was continued through a Focus Group Discussion (FGD). From the research it was found that there was a significant positive influence between the problem-based learning (PBL) model variable and student learning outcomes, which meant that student learning outcomes could be improved through the application of the Problem Based Learning (PBL) learning model.

The problem faced in this study is the low science learning outcomes in material related to chemistry. The purpose of this study was to determine the improvement of student learning outcomes through the Laboratory Inquiry learning model on acid, alkaline, and salt material in class VII of SMP 1 Percut Sei Tuan Tahun. Action research was conducted in class VII of SMP Negeri 1 Percut Sei Tuan with a total of 32 students. The research took place in 2 cycles by expressing four stages in each cycle, namely: the stages of planning, implementation, observation, and reflection. Analysis of research data in the form of quantitative and qualitative data which is the student learning outcomes (pre-test and post-test) and the results of observations of students' skills utilizing percentage, namely by calculating the increase in student mastery learning individually. The results of the first cycle test, there were 17 students (53.13%) had achieved mastery learning while 15 students (46.87%) had not achieved mastery learning. After it was found that there was an increase, it continued to give action in the second cycle. Then the results of the second cycle test were found to have a substantial increase in the number of students completing, namely from 32 students. It turned out that 28 students (87.50%) had achieved mastery learning, only four students (12.50%) had not reached completeness in learning. Students' skills in conducting practicum have increased significantly. Based on the results of the first cycle test and the second cycle test, it can be concluded that the Laboratory Inquiry Learning Model on Acid, Base, and Salt material can improve the learning outcomes of junior high school students.

This study aims to determine the effectiveness of entrepreneurship learning models based on social missions to advance entrepreneurial interest in vocational high school students. Experimental research use as a method, with 72 students participating in Class XII of SMK Negeri 1 Kudus. Data collection using questionnaires and learning outcomes. Data analysis using ANOVA and Scheffe test. The results showed that student learning outcomes with social mission learning models and conventional learning models have differences, where the social mission learning model is more useful to improve student learning outcomes and entrepreneurial interest. More than that, the social mission-based entrepreneurship learning model is needed in the curriculum. Entrepreneurship training through social mission will prepare students to become entrepreneurs, in addition to being more concerned about the environment and society. Future research needs to focus more on studying entrepreneurship learning curricula in vocational high schools.

Learning through interactive media gives additional value to the educational world because it enables learners to represent themselves. Game-based learning promotes learners’ creativity, critical thinking and cognitive skills related to technology use. Previous research discovered that game-based learning has a positive effect on learners. Therefore, in this research, an applied study was conducted on the use of the E-CrowdWar educational game with high school students. The purpose of this study was to determine the effectiveness of using games in learning to improve student learning outcomes. The study was conducted with 100 high school students in Blitar and 100 in Kediri. E-CrowdWar was used during the classroom activities along with in-class learning. An independent sample t-test was used to measure the effectiveness of game-based learning. The integration of games into online learning had a significantly positive effect on student learning outcomes. The pre-test results showed that the average student learning outcome score in both cities was the same, namely 65 points. After implementing game-based learning, student learning outcomes in Kediri increased to 90.74 points and in Blitar to 86.95 points. The study discovered that game-based learning through E-CrowdWar was effective in promoting the students’ academic outcomes, although there were differences in the mean score. Based on the results, game-based learning provides tremendous improvements in learning outcomes and so should be applied, especially in the economic field. The problem that occurs in the education world right now is the low learning outcomes and student creativity. Based on references, the roles playing method is an effective learning method for increasing student creativity and learning outcomes. The purpose of this study is to determine the effectiveness of the roles playing method on creativity and student learning outcomes and to find out the effectiveness of the roles playing method on learning the immune system. This research is a quasi-experimental research with nonequivalent control group design. The population are all students of grade 11 in MIA MAN 2 Semarang 2018/2019 school year. The sample is determined by purposive sampling and 2 classes have selected as the experimental class and the control class. In this study the experimental class carried out immune system learning using the roles playing method while the control class used the lecture method. The results showed that 85.56% of the experimental class students has creativity with creative to very creative categories while the control class is only 41.67% of students included in the creative and very creative categories. Student learning outcomes data show that the classical learning completeness of the experimental class is higher than the control class with a difference of 36.12%. The average value of learning outcomes and the average N-Gain score of the experimental class students also have a higher average value of the control class. The implementation of learning the roles playing method gained a score of 95.56%. Based on the description it can be concluded that the role playing method is effective on the creativity and learning outcomes of high school students and it can be concluded that the role playing method is effectively applied to learning the immune system because the results of the study already meet all the indicators that have been set.
